- What is Citizens's international insurance segment — policyholders' dividends?
- Citizens (CIA) reported international insurance segment — policyholders' dividends of $1.04M in Q1 2026.
- How has Citizens's international insurance segment — policyholders' dividends changed year-over-year?
- Citizens's international insurance segment — policyholders' dividends decreased by 12.6% year-over-year, from $1.19M to $1.04M.
- What does international insurance segment — policyholders' dividends mean?
- This represents the portion of earnings or surplus distributed to policyholders in the international insurance segment, typically associated with participating insurance contracts. It reflects the company's commitment to sharing performance results with its customers. Monitoring this helps evaluate the competitive nature of the segment's product offerings.
